Default Mob AC DB Update

For those of you who dont like ac=0 for all mobs i made my own .sql file to help you guys out. It takes awhile to source but its worth it.

NOTE: This has not been tested yet it runs fine in the DB but havent tested it in world yet.

USE THIS AT YOUR OWN RISK

BACKUP YOUR DB FIRST

I've got my own formula set up atm but i also included the source code i used to make it in a different file so feel free to tweak around with it a bit if you dont like the number.

I've got it grouped where Plate has highest ac, then Chain, then Leather, then casters. The numbers i started with are based on the AC of A warror i made in game and checked out his ac.
